A Casino That Feels Like Home

Walk into Banco Casino Bratislava and you’ll understand why it’s the place for The Festival. The casino is located within the Crowne Plaza Hotel in downtown Bratislava, which means you can roll out of bed and be at the poker tables in minutes. It’s open 24/7 and features the largest poker room in Slovakia, so there’s always space for a game. The atmosphere is relaxed and comfortable – no stuffy vibes here – and the staff are very friendly and professional, making everyone feel welcome from the moment they arrive. Bratislava – The Perfect Poker Playground

What makes the city of Bratislava such a hit with players? For starters, location, location, location! The casino sits right in the city center, directly opposite the Presidential Palace and close to everything. Travelers find it super easy to get here, Bratislava’s airport is nearby, and Vienna’s international airport is just an hour away by car or train. People come from all over Europe to play here, and many just drive in from neighboring countries like Austria, Hungary, Poland, and the Czech Republic. It’s a quick trip and totally worth it.

Once you arrive, Bratislava gets your interest instantly. The historic Old Town with its cozy cafes and bars is a short walk from the casino. Picture narrow cobblestone streets, a mix of classic and modern architecture, and that beautiful castle on the hill watching over the city. The vibe is laid-back and welcoming, many speak at least some English and ate happy to help with directions or share a recommendation. Prices in Bratislava are friendly on the wallet too, which poker travellers definitely appreciate (more budget for buy-ins or beers!). When you’re not playing, you can enjoy a stroll along the Danube River, check out cool local pubs, or taste authentic Slovak cuisine (yes, bryndzové halušky – the cheesy dumplings – are a must-try). The city’s nightlife is surprisingly lively for a small capital, but also not as chaotic or pricey as bigger tourist hubs. Big Fields and Unforgettable Moments

Banco Casino Bratislava isn’t just a cozy spot; it’s also where history is made for The Festival Series. Ever since the very first Festival here in 2021, the turnout and energy have been incredible. In fact, the 2021 The Festival Main Event drew 621 players – quite a debut – and crowned Martin Mauthner as champion, who took home a €59,000 prize after an epic finale. It was the start of something special.

Fast forward to 2022, and things reached a whole new level. That year, The Festival ran the first-ever €500,000 guaranteed event in Slovakia, and it smashed records. Dutch player Michel Molenaar dominated a field of 1,261 entries to win the Main Event for a whopping €126,650 – the largest tournament payout in Slovak poker history. Imagine the scene: the poker room packed with over a thousand entries, the tension, the cheers – absolute madness. Banco Casino’s poker room truly proved it could handle a massive event, and then some. The staff dealt with the huge field like pros, and the whole week had an amazing vibe.

Then came 2023, and the momentum continued. The Festival that year was, in one word, epic. There were 54 different events (poker plus casino games), and the vibe was off the charts. Players from dozens of countries showed up, making it a truly international gathering. A young Polish player named Gabriel Rymar stole the show, he not only won the Main Event (outlasting 1,025 entries to bank €80,000 for first place) but also took down a Bratislava Deepstack side event for another €14,400. Two trophies in one Festival! Talk about making a statement. The Main Event final table in 2023 was streamed live, as always, and had railbirds (and Twitch viewers) on the edge of their seats, especially when it came down to Rymar versus Christoforos Christoforou for the title. Rymar’s victory was celebrated by everyone – here was a relatively unknown player turning into a champion in front of our eyes. And guess who was also close to that final table aiming for another title? Yep, Michel Molenaar, the 2022 champ, who was hunting for a second trophy. He fell short this time, but it added value knowing a two-time winner was nearly crowned. These are the kind of storylines that keep coming back, as well as in 2024, when Sebastian Kotowicz crowned himself as champion, and another Polish champion made history on the spot.
